United States Merchant Marine Academy is a four-year, public school located in Kings Point, NY.
It is a military college - Federal Service Academies
It is classified as Baccalaureate College - Diverse Fields by Carnegie Classification.
United States Merchant Marine Academy is accredited by Middle States Commission on Higher Education.

34% Acceptance Rate

For 2024-25 admission, 1,367 applied, 468 accepted, and 300 enrolled in USMMA.
239 men and 61 women first-time, full-time students enrolled.

1,200 SAT, 25 ACT

In 2024-25, the average SAT score is 1,200 and ACT score is 25. The SAT score of 1200 is good, 74 to 81 as in percentile.

2025 Tuition & Fees

The 2025 tuition & fees are $895 for undergraduate programs.
Tuition has decreased by 5.29% compared to last year at United States Merchant Marine Academy.

Financial Aid

104 undergraduate students have awarded and the average amount of the aid awarded is $4,509.
For freshmen, 53 students (27%) have received financial aid and its average amount is $4,374.

Student Population

A total of 976 students enrolled USMMA in 2025.
By gender, 799 men and 177 women students are enrolled.
There are 962 undergraduate and 14 graduate students.

Graduation Rate

The graduation rate of USMMA is 82% and the transfer-out rate is 18%.
The retention rate is 84% for full-time and 84% for part-time students.

Facutly & Staffs

A total of 145 faculties (instructional staffs) are working for USMMA and the average faculty salary is $106,878. The studetns to faculty ratio is 13 to 1.
There are 296 non-instructional staffs and the average staff salary is $117,603.
